Abstract
An operation panel that is incorporated in an apparatus generating vibration during operation, and displays an operation screen of the apparatus to receive operation from a user includes: a touch panel that includes a display area of the operation screen, and detects contact between an external object and the display area; a vibration generation unit that applies vibration to the display area; a vibration storage unit that stores a spectrum of vibration generated by operation of the apparatus as a spectrum of background vibration; and a response control unit that checks whether the apparatus is in a standby state or an operating state, and causes the vibration generation unit to apply vibration indicating a first spectrum to the display area when the apparatus is in the standby state, and vibration indicating a second spectrum to the display area when the apparatus is in the operating state.
